Baiheda

Madhya Pradesh — Shajapur, Shajapur • Rural
Baiheda is a rural settlement in Shajapur, Shajapur, Madhya Pradesh. It has a population of 1,150 in about 226 households (avg size: 5.09). Approximate literacy: 61.83%.

Population of Baiheda

Population (Total)1,150
Male603
Female547
Children (0–6 years)187
Households226
Literate persons711
Illiterate persons439
Total workers580
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)907
Literacy (approx.)61.83%
SC population309
ST population17
